Teachers: Rosalind Weston Content: If you wonder how to be a woman's advocate by changing rules to suit you but staying within acceptable parameters, this is the tape for you. Rosalind details her personal experience working for the National Health Service in the United Kingdom as well as being a homebirth midwife. She stresses evidence based practice and the skills needed to be a self-employed business person who is constantly challenged with protocols and guidelines. She discusses relevant paperwork, midwives' code of practice, insurance, fees, equipment, isolation, networking with other practitioners, documentation, and marketing, among many other things. In a question and answer section, this very able teacher's responses to each query are thorough and satisfying.
